Ilford Station is designed to cater to the needs of modern travelers with its extensive range of facilities. The station's ticket office operates from 06:10 to 20: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ly adjusted hours on Sundays, offering flexibility for ticket purchases. For added convenience, ticket machines are available at all entrances, including accessible machines to accommodate all passengers. Furthermore, you can collect online tickets at these machines, ensuring a seamless experience.
Accessibility is a priority at Ilford Station, with step-free access provided from Cranbrook Road and Ilford Hill. The station also boasts induction loops, accessible toilets on platforms 3 and 4 (with Radar Key access), and staff available to assist passengers with mobility needs. Warm, step-free waiting rooms equipped with automatic doors enhance the comfort for those waiting at Platform 3.
Once you've arrived at Ilford Station, you'll discover a multitude of onward travel options. Local transport links are abundant, with Transport for London buses conveniently stationed outside, offering easy connections throughout the region. The rail replacement bus service ensures continuity during disruptions, departing from High Road and Ilford Hill, depending on the direction you're headed.
Additionally, Ilford Station serves as a convenient step into global travel, with the Elizabeth Line providing a direct route to Heathrow Airport. This makes it an excellent starting point for those embarking on international travels.

Starbeck Station offers a range of ticketing and travel assistance facilities to cater to your needs. Though there isn't a 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for purchasing and collecting tickets, including those bought online. For the tech-savvy traveler, smartcards are issued and validated at the station for a seamless travel experience.
While the station is not staffed, customers can reference helpful screens for departure information and announcements. Phone assistance is available if you require it, but do note the absence of a waiting room, luggage storage, or CCTV. The good news is, however, that step-free access is provided to both platforms, making it a category B station with mobility scooter compatibility. Do be aware that toilet and baby changing facilities are not available, so plan accordingly.
Getting around from Starbeck station is straightforward thanks to several transport links. Rail replacement services are conveniently located at bus stops near the level crossing. For easier travel around town, taxis are accessible through this service.
Those looking to explore the lovely surrounds of Starbeck and nearby destinations can benefit from the Transdev Harrogate & District bus services, making it easier to access various towns and villages around Harrogate. Consider purchasing a PLUSBUS ticket alongside your train ticket for unlimited bus travel across Starbeck and its neighboring areas, offering excellent value. For more information on bus service routes and timetables, you can visit Harrogate and District.
